中央纪委国家监委:坚决纠治临近换届等待观望不作为
Xin Lang Cai Jing· 2026-02-26 11:29
Group 1 - The central government has reported a total of 22,554 cases of violations of the Central Eight Regulations in January 2026, with 28,544 individuals receiving criticism or disciplinary action, including 20,446 receiving party and administrative sanctions [1] - Among the violations, 8,806 cases were related to non-performance and misconduct affecting high-quality development, accounting for 84.7% of the total formalism and bureaucratism issues addressed that month [1] - The types of violations related to hedonism and extravagance included 57.4% for the illegal acceptance of valuable gifts, 21.5% for illegal dining, and 11.1% for illegal allowances or benefits [1] Group 2 - The 20th Central Commission for Discipline Inspection's fifth plenary session has prioritized strengthening discipline and consolidating the educational outcomes of the Central Eight Regulations as an annual task [2] - Continuous efforts will be made to combat hedonism and extravagance, particularly focusing on issues like illegal dining and gift-giving, while also addressing formalism and bureaucratism [2] - The aim is to guide party organizations and members to establish and practice a correct view of achievements, supporting the comprehensive advancement of national construction and the rejuvenation of the nation through Chinese-style modernization [2]

持之以恒为基层减负
Jing Ji Ri Bao· 2026-02-12 00:37
Core Viewpoint - The central government is addressing formalism to reduce burdens on grassroots levels, highlighting the persistent issues stemming from misaligned performance views and lack of responsibility, which replace substantial implementation with superficial actions [1][2]. Group 1: Issues of Formalism - Formalism manifests as a disconnect between knowledge and action, ineffective practices, excessive documentation, and a focus on superficial achievements rather than genuine results [1]. - Recent reports indicate that some localities issue unrealistic targets, impose additional tasks, and overlook false data, leading to increased burdens on grassroots workers [1]. - The complexity of assessment indicators and frequent rankings contribute to the over-reliance on trace management, further straining grassroots resources [1]. Group 2: Government Initiatives - President Xi Jinping has consistently emphasized the need to combat formalism and bureaucratism, aiming to liberate grassroots workers from these constraints [2]. - A series of regulations and guidelines have been established, including the 2020 notice outlining eight requirements to alleviate formalism and the 2024 regulations that formalize the reduction of burdens on grassroots levels [3]. Group 3: Practical Measures and Outcomes - Local governments have implemented targeted measures, such as creating clear responsibility lists for townships and streets, resulting in the addition of 15,200 positions to support grassroots governance [4]. - The simplification of reports sent from central departments to local levels has reduced paperwork by 57.2%, demonstrating effective measures against formalism [4]. Group 4: Long-term Challenges - The fight against formalism is recognized as a long-term endeavor, with the potential for new forms of formalism to emerge, particularly with the introduction of digital systems that may inadvertently increase burdens [4]. - Continuous vigilance is necessary to prevent the resurgence of old issues and the emergence of new ones related to formalism [4]. Group 5: Future Directions - The "14th Five-Year Plan" emphasizes the need for ongoing efforts to reduce burdens on grassroots levels, ensuring effective implementation of central policies [5]. - There is a call for accountability without reducing responsibilities, focusing on practical results and enhancing the capabilities of grassroots organizations [5][6].
发展农村集体经济决不能弄虚作假
第一财经· 2026-02-06 08:19
Core Viewpoint - The development of rural collective economy is crucial for empowering comprehensive rural revitalization and promoting common prosperity among farmers, but issues such as unrealistic targets, falsification, and superficial projects must be addressed [3][4]. Group 1: Issues in Rural Collective Economy - Some regions set high targets without considering actual conditions, leading to falsification of data when targets are unmet [3][6]. - Falsification in rural collective economy often manifests as "over-posting" and "inflation" of income, where funds from higher authorities are misclassified as operational income [3][4]. - Such practices may meet reporting requirements but do not benefit the actual development of rural collective economies, fostering a culture of formalism [4]. Group 2: Correcting Performance Views - There is a need to establish a correct view of performance that aligns with local realities, avoiding blind target-setting from higher authorities [5][6]. - A correct performance view should involve setting feasible task indicators based on local conditions, emphasizing practical results and effectiveness [7]. - The members of rural collective economic organizations should have a voice in assessing the correctness of performance views, ensuring their interests and satisfaction are prioritized [7]. Group 3: Policy Implementation and Resource Utilization - The implementation of policies should be tailored to local agricultural conditions, avoiding oversimplification in execution [8]. - Recent efforts in some areas to cultivate agricultural specialty industries have improved rural collective economic income and infrastructure, but many resources remain underutilized [9]. - The "No. 1 Document" emphasizes the orderly market entry of rural collective operational construction land, which can support the development of collective economies and rural industries [9]. Group 4: Measuring True Development - The fundamental measure of whether rural collective economies are genuinely developing lies in whether members see real benefits, experience income growth, and have reduced burdens [9].
